原文:JSX 到 JS 的转换

在写react代码的时候,大部分同学应该都是写JSX。因为相比于写纯JavaScript。写JSX为我们去写组件,比写一些在JavaScript当中写类似于html结构的这种代码是要方便非常非常多的,他的可阅读性,可维护性都要高很多的。那么JSX他的魔力在哪里,能够让我们在JS里面写html代码。 JSX相对于JavaScript来讲,他的唯一的一个区别就是他可以写类似于html的标签。 htt ...

2019-11-06 21:34 0 290 推荐指数:

查看详情

React的使用与JSX转换

前置技能:Chrome浏览器 一.拿糖:React的使用 React v0.14 RC 发布,主要更新项目: 两个包: React 和 React D ...

Thu Jun 02 05:17:00 CST 2016 0 6957
JSJSX的区别

概念1.js,是一种直译式脚本语言2.jsx,JavaScript XML是一种在React组件内部构建标签的类XML语 法。 区别1.浏览器只能识别不同的JS和CSS,不能识别SCSS或者JSX,所以webpack的作用就是把SCSS转换成CSS,把JSX转换JS,然后在浏览器正常使用 ...

Wed Jul 22 17:29:00 CST 2020 0 3797
React JsJSX

  React使用JSX作为模板替换JavaScript,它不是必须的,但是它是推荐使用。原因如下:     1.它比传统的JavaScript更快,因为编译代码的时候,JSX做了相应的优化     2.它是类型安全的,在编译代码的过程中会捕获大量的错误。     3.它是编写模板变得更简单 ...

Mon Sep 25 23:37:00 CST 2017 0 1087
jsx编译成js

对于一个只想使用一下react批量渲染的后端程序员来说,配置完整的编译环境可以没有必要,最好一条命令搞定。jsx其实就是js的语法糖,需要用编译工具编译下。 方法首先安装node.js,里面默认带了npm的包管理。 //命令行中全局安装 npm install --save-dev ...

Thu Nov 01 21:50:00 CST 2018 0 1011
React中jsx调用js例子

需求: 界面新增一个“导入项目”按钮,点击该按钮可以执行项目导入功能。按钮点击事件部分是jsx语法代码,而项目导入部分是封装的js语法代码,假设此处用alert("123")代替。若点击按钮出现alert("123")弹框,表示onClick事件执行了js语法代码。 具体示例如下: 项目导入 ...

Fri Mar 29 05:17:00 CST 2019 0 3493
传统jsjsx与ts和tsx的区别

一、从定义文件格式方面说 1、传统的开发模式可以定义js文件或者jsx文件2、利用ts开发定义的文件格式tsx二、定义state的状态来说 1、传统的方式直接在构造函数中使用 2、使用ts开发过程中需要先定义一个接口,规范数据类型,通过泛型传入到类中 ...

Thu Dec 19 22:26:00 CST 2019 0 36606
传统jsjsx与ts和tsx的区别

一、从定义文件格式方面说 1、传统的开发模式可以定义js文件或者jsx文件2、利用ts开发定义的文件格式tsx 二、定义state的状态来说 1、传统的方式直接在构造函数中使用 constructor(){ this.state = { num1:10 ...

Thu Dec 12 01:34:00 CST 2019 0 2669
传统jsjsx ts和tsx的区别

一、从定义文件格式方面说 1、传统的开发模式可以定义js文件或者jsx文件2、利用ts开发定义的文件格式tsx 二、定义state的状态来说 1、传统的方式直接在构造函数中使用 constructor(){ this.state = { num1:10 ...

Tue May 12 18:11:00 CST 2020 0 826
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M